Course Content

• Introduction to Nanoscale Biophysics Research
• Principles of Nanotechnology for Biological Applications
• Biomolecular Interactions at the Nanoscale: (includes single molecule manipulation, optical and force spectroscopy)
• Nanoscale Imaging Techniques in Biophysics (e.g., AFM, TEM, Cryo-EM)
• Nanomaterials in Biomedical Applications: Drug Delivery and Diagnostics
• Data Analysis and Interpretation in Nanoscale Biophysics
• Ethical and Societal Implications of Nanoscale Biophysics Research
• Advanced Nanoscale Biophysics Techniques (e.g., super-resolution microscopy, single-cell analysis)

Nanoscale Biophysics Research: UK Career Outlook

Career Role Description
Nanoscale Biophysics Researcher Conducting cutting-edge research in nanoscale biophysics, employing advanced techniques and contributing to scientific publications. High demand for expertise in microscopy and data analysis.
Biomedical Nanomaterials Scientist Developing and characterizing novel nanomaterials for biomedical applications. Strong background in materials science and biology required, with a focus on drug delivery and diagnostics.
Nanomedicine Engineer Designing and developing nanotechnology-based therapies and diagnostic tools. Requires strong engineering skills alongside knowledge of biological systems and regulatory affairs.
Biophysicist (with Nanoscale Focus) Applying biophysical principles to understand nanoscale biological systems. Expertise in single-molecule techniques, computational modeling, and advanced imaging is highly valuable.
